Upright Bikes
Upright bikes are developed to imitate outside cycling with a straight-up seating posture. They are perfect for users seeking a full-body exercise while improving cardiovascular fitness.
2. Recumbent Bikes
These bikes allow the user to sit in a reclined position with back assistance, making them ideal for older grownups or those recovering from injuries. The style lessens pressure on the back while still providing a cardiovascular workout.
3. Spin Bikes
Spin bikes are constructed for high-intensity period training (HIIT) and are typically utilized in spinning classes. They include adjustable tension to mimic biking on different surfaces. These bikes are especially popular amongst fitness lovers who want to press their limits.
4. Hybrid Bikes
A mix of upright and recumbent styles, hybrid bikes accommodate a range of users by allowing seat adjustments for various riding positions.

When selecting a home stationary bicycle, it's important to examine particular functions that align with individual fitness goals. Below are some essential elements to think about:
Adjustable Seat Height: Ensures proper posture and convenience throughout exercises.Resistance Levels: More levels enable varied workouts and development as strength improves.Show Console: Should track metrics such as time, range, speed, and calories burned.Pedal System: Look for adjustable pedals with straps for a protected fit.Integrated Programs: Bikes with pre-programmed programs can supply guided exercises and motivation.Bluetooth Connective Features: Some bikes permit connection to fitness apps for boosted tracking and engagement.Maintenance and Care
Taking care of an exercise bike can extend its lifespan and guarantee a high-quality workout experience. Here are essential maintenance pointers:
Cleaning: Wipe down the bike after every use to avoid accumulation of dust and sweat.Lubing Moving Parts: Regularly check and oil the chain and other moving parts to keep them functioning smoothly.Tightening Up Bolts and Screws: Ensure the bike stays steady by examining all screws and bolts periodically.Saving Properly: If the bike is foldable, shop it in a dry area to prevent rusting or damage.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How much area do I require for a home exercise bike?
A lot of exercise bikes require an area of about 5 to 10 square feet, depending upon the design. Think about additional area for convenience and movement.
2. Are exercise bikes appropriate for all fitness levels?
Yes, exercise bikes accommodate all fitness levels. Adjustable resistance and seat configurations make them accessible for newbies and experts alike.
3. How typically should I utilize a home exercise bike?
For ideal results, go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ity weekly. This can correspond to about 30 minutes of biking per day, five times a week.
4. Do I need special shoes for spin bikes?
While not necessary, biking shoes are recommended for spin bikes as they offer better support and allow you to clip into the pedals for boosted control.
5. How do I choose the ideal bike for my needs?
Assess your fitness objectives, assess readily available area, and consider spending plan restrictions. It may also be helpful to test trip various models before making a purchase.
